40 NEW SUBURBAN SERVICES ANNOUNCED BY
GENERAL MANAGER, WR ON REPUBLIC DAY

MUMBAI : The dawn of 59th anniversary of Republic Day of our nation was marked on Western Railway with flag hoisting by Shri R.N. Verma, General Manager, Western Railway. Keeping with the motto of caring for its customers and providing with more comforts, General Manager announced the introduction of 40 new suburban services from 26th January, 2009. 23 new suburban services were introduced in November 2008, thus taking it to 63 new suburban services this financial year. Every effort is being taken by WR to ease the load on trains on Borivali – Virar sector and this is one step to provide relief to the commuters of this sector. Virar sector services, have thus gone up from 370 to 402. Renewal of Season tickets through Automatic Ticket Vending Machines (ATVMs) and Ticketing through Mobile are likely to be introduced within this financial year. In our continuous endeavour to improve passenger services, current All India Radio news is being relayed during the journey of Rajdhani Express trains since August 2008. A new initiative of sending updated rail related information via SMSs has been found very useful by railway users and 56000 persons have signed up for this service.
Recalling duty of railwaymen towards the country and reviewing Railway’s performance during the year, General Manager in his address expressed how the cash strapped Indian Railways is now a cash surplus organisation, due to the visionary policies of Hon’ble Minister for Railways, Shri Lalu Prasad.
Shri Verma highlighted that Western Railway being one of the important Zonal Railways of the Indian Railways has been giving significant contribution in all the areas of railway activities including freight and passenger business. WR has achieved a freight traffic loading of 36.66 million tonnes up to December which is approximately 14.5% more than the corresponding period of last year. He also added that there has been a growth of 26% over last year, up to December, in respect of freight traffic earnings. On the passenger side also, the earnings have grown by 11%. 929 Holiday Specials have been run and about 7000 extra coaches attached in different trains and 6 new trains have been introduced up till now.
On the construction front, various projects have been completed like the Gauge Conversion of Pratapnagar – Dabhoi line and Mahesana – Patan and new line of Veraval – Somnath. An additional pair of passenger trains between Pratapnagar – Dabhoi is introduced from 26th January 2009. The works introduced in the current budget are Gauge Conversion of Ratlam – Indore – Khandwa and Ahmedabad – Udaipur lines and doubling of Udhna – Jalgaon section.
Emphasising on the safety and security of its public, Shri Verma said that a foolproof security system is provided to the rail users. CCTVs have been installed at 38 stations and are under commission at 13 other stations. Quick Response Teams (QRTs) equipped with metal detectors, dog squads and superior INSAS rifles have been deployed over Western Railway. One Bomb Disposal Unit in each division is under the process of being set up soon.
